Overview Omimed 20mg Capsule

AcidGard 20mg Capsules lower stomach acid production. They treat stomach and intestinal conditions like heartburn, acid reflux, pe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ome, easing symptoms and aiding healing. Ideally, take one capsule an hour before meals, preferably in the morning. Dosage depends on your condition and response; continue as prescribed even with symptom improvement. Smaller, more frequent meals, and avoiding caffeine, spicy, and fatty foods enhance treatment. Common, usually mild, side effects include nausea, vomiting, headache, gas, diarrhea, and stomach ache.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ical attention. Prolonged use (over a year) may increase fracture risk, particularly at higher doses; discuss bone loss prevention with your doctor. Inform your doctor about prior severe liver issues, allergies to similar medications, or osteoporosis before starting treatment. Interactions with other medications are possible; disclose all medications, especially those for HIV, fungal infections, tuberculosis, epilepsy, or blood thinners.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should consult their physician before use.

How Omimed 20mg Capsule works:

Each 20mg Omimed capsule, a proton pump inhibitor, lessens stomach acid production, thus alleviating heartburn, acid reflux, pe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ol concurrently with Omimed 20mg Capsules is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Omimed 20mg Cap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the potential benefits against any ris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Omimed 20mg Capsules while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Driving ability while using Omimed 20mg Capsules is undetermined. Refrain from driving if you experience sym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Omimed 20mg capsules may be administered to patients with kidney disease without requiring a dosage modification.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with severe h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Omimed 20mg Capsules.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is recommended. Reduced dosages might be appropriate for individuals with liver disease requiring prolonged Omimed 20mg Capsule therapy.

What if you forget to take Omimed 20mg Capsule :

Should you forget a dose of Omimed 20mg Capsule,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osage reg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Omimed 20mg Capsule

Clinically, Omimed 20mg Capsule can be safely co-administered with domperidone; a fixed-dose combination is also available. This combination effectively treats reflux esophagitis, heartburn, and stomach and intestinal ulcers by combining domperidone's gut motility-enhancing action with Omimed's acid-reducing effect.
Avoid this medication if you're using atazanavir or nelfinavir (HIV medications). Inform your doctor of any liver issues, persistent diarrhea or vomiting, dark or bloody stools, unexplained weight loss, swallowing difficulties, stomach pain, or indigestion. List all other medications you're taking, as interactions are possible. Report any prior allergic skin reactions to this medicine. It's unsuitable for children under 1 year or weighing less than 10 kg.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before use.
Yes, diarrhea is a possible side effect for some users. While usually mild, persistent watery stools accompanied by stomach cramps and fever require immediate medical attention.
Follow your doctor's instructions regarding treatment duration, as this may vary. Always consult your doctor before discontinuing this medication.
Prolonged use can thin bones (osteoporosis) by reducing calcium absorption, increasing fracture risk (hips, wrists, spine). If you have osteoporosis or take corticosteroids (which increase osteoporosis risk), tell your doctor before starting treatment. Discuss preventative measures with your doctor, who may recommend calcium or vitamin D supplements.
Prolonged use exceeding three months may cause side effects, most notably low blood magnesium, leading to fatigue, confusion, dizziness, shakiness, muscle twitching, or irregular heartbeat. Use exceeding one year increases the risk of bone fractures (due to low blood calcium), particularly in the hip, wrist, or spine, alongside stomach infections and vitamin B12 deficiency. Vitamin B12 deficiency can cause anemia, resulting in fatigue, weakness, paleness, palpitations, shortness of breath, lightheadedness, indigestion, appetite loss, gas, and neurological symptoms like numbness, tingling, and gait problems.
This medication can lead to vitamin B12 and vitamin C deficiencies. Oral vitamin B12 absorption depends on stomach acid, reduced by this drug, necessitating potential B12 supplementation. While decreased vitamin C levels may occur, supplementation isn't currently advised.
Individuals with heart conditions may use this medication as directed by their physician. Note that it can interact with some cardiac medications (such as clopidogrel and digoxin), requiring close medical supervision if taken concurrently.
